Back to newsA new heat wave is moving across Greece, bringing temperatures up to 38°C (100°F) in Crete and reaching 39°C (102°F) on the mainland. Visitors currently on the island or planning to arrive in the coming days should prepare for intense midday heat. Avoid outdoor activity between 12:00 and 17:00, stay well hydrated, and apply high-SPF sunscreen regularly. If you plan to hike, visit archaeological sites such as Knossos, or explore mountain villages, schedule these activities for early morning or late afternoon. Keep water readily available at all times. Children, elderly travelers, and those with health conditions should take extra precautions. Air-conditioned accommodation, museum visits, and shaded beach areas with sea breezes offer relief during peak heat hours. Monitor local forecasts daily as conditions may intensify.
